French High Court Reaffirms Prison Sentence for Holocaust-denying Professor

The Court of Cassation rejected the appeal last week of Vincent Reynouard, was filmed saying the Holocaust may not have happened and called state commemorations of the deportation of French Jews 'manipulation of memory.'
